A good project manager can save a hundred thousand dollars

These aren't our words, but we sure agree with them! Risk identification and mitigation, task dependency, resource allocation - these are just a few of the important tasks that our project managers are entrusted with.

Having good project management is important. You can have all of the most fantastic programmers in the world, but if they are working on the wrong thing at the wrong time -- the project fails. 60% of all IT projects fail (either over budget - or over time), which is why you need to feel confident that your projects are adequately scoped, estimated, designed in each iteration of development.

drop jaw, liquid interfaces

Launch understand the importance of an attractive user interface. It's not just being pretty - a simple, clutter free interface is easy to follow and therefore efficient to use. User interfaces should assist the user in what they really want to do, and guide them visually to their next task.
